A simple method to estimate the surface tensions of binary alloys has been developed by assuming that the partial molar excess free energies are proportional to the number of nearest neighbors in both the bulk solution and in the surface itself. We have calculated free energy and vibrational entropy differences in ni 3al between its equilibrium ordered structure and a disordered fcc solid solution.
